Tripoli: The Institute of Diplomatic Studies at the Ministry of Foreign Affairs and International Cooperation and the French Cultural Institute held a meeting to explore opportunities for collaboration in training and development. Khaled Abu Khreis, Director of the Institute of Diplomatic Studies, and Jean-Bernard Boulvin, Director of the French Cultural Office and Institute at the French Embassy in Libya, led the discussions focused on joint initiatives.
According to Libyan News Agency, the meeting emphasized a collaborative initiative aimed at training and developing translators from the Translation Office at the Ministry of Foreign Affairs and International Cooperation. The program will involve specialized training in simultaneous interpretation, to be conducted in France.
This initiative aligns with the Institute’s mission to enhance national expertise in diplomatic and linguistic translation, thereby supporting and advancing Libyan diplomatic efforts on the global stage.
